Digital library to come up in Andhra Pradesh's Kadapa Central Prison

KADAPA: As part of efforts to reform prisoners at Kadapa Central Prison, a digital library and furniture making training centre would soon be set up here. In a recent move, the state prisons department has decided to introduce digital libraries in central prisons at Rajamahendravaram, Nellore and Kadapa, and Rs 4.7 lakh was allocated to each prison for the purpose.

Six inmates would be able to read at a digital library at a time. Also, the furniture making training centre would be established at a cost of Rs 2.1 crore with coordination from Hindustan Petroleum. More than 100 prisoners would receive training for it.

After their release, the prisoners could eke out a living with the help of their skills, the officials said. Superintendent B Lakshminarasaiah said the Kadapa Central prison was earning Rs 50 lakh as income through the petrol bunk, industries and canteen being run by the prisoners. Also, the prisoners have been divided into skilled, semi-skilled and unskilled categories and are paid Rs 70, Rs 50 and Rs 30 respectively.

To educate the inmates, the AP Open University has opened a centre on the prison premises where many finished their UG and PG courses. Kadapa prison was set up in 1991 and upgraded into a central prison in 1992. At present, it has about 1,000 convicts.
